WebAlbumin Blood Test An albumin blood test checks your liver and kidney function. Albumin is protein in your blood plasma. Low albumin levels might be the result of kidney disease, liver disease, inflammation or infections. High albumin levels are usually the result of dehydration or severe diarrhea. WebTotal protein: This is a measurement of the total amount of albumin and globulins, which are proteins in your blood. Bilirubin: This is a waste product that’s made from the breakdown of red blood cells. Your liver is in charge of removing bilirubin from your body. WebNov 24, 2024 · The American Board of Internal Medicine lists the following reference ranges for a test of proteins in the blood: Total proteins: 5.5 to 9.0 g/dL. Albumin: 3.5 to 5.5 g/dL. Globulins: 2.0 to 3.5 g/dL. When total protein levels are abnormally high, it can be related to conditions that cause chronic inflammation. Normal urine elimination is less than 150 mg total protein per day and less than 30 mg albumin daily. The urine total protein to creatinine ratio or UPCR (mg/mg) is normally less than 0.2 for adults. Elevated urine protein levels may be seen temporarily with conditions such as infections, stress, pregnancy, diet, cold ...
